Park Tae-hwan unveiled an apartment in Seongsu-dong, Seoul, priced at 100 million won per pyeong.

In season 2 of MBN's real variety show 'Let's Go GO', which aired on the 20th, Park Tae-hwan, Korea's first Olympic swimming gold medalist and currently active as a commentator, appeared.

Park Tae-hwan's house caught the eye with its neat interior. I could see the Han River from the living room. It was also full of things Taehwan Park usually likes, such as figures, wine, and shoes.

Ahn Jung-hwan and Hong Hyun-hee first met Tae-hwan Park and had an honest conversation about various topics, including the reason he started swimming, stories about his parents, and stories about swimmers who followed in Tae-hwan Park's footsteps.

Park Tae-hwan mentioned Kim Woo-min and Hwang Sun-woo as promising swimmers for this Olympics. Regarding Kim Woo-min, he said, “If you look at the record alone, he is a player who should surpass me, but he has a really good sense of race speed.” Regarding Hwang Sun-woo, he said, “He is already good at racing speed.” He is a player who surpasses me. He praised him, saying, “I have as good instantaneous speed as a sprinter,” raising expectations for the Olympics.

Next, when asked, "Don't you think you wish your juniors didn't win the gold medal?" Park Tae-hwan honestly confessed, "I was like that for a while when I was out of the season and not playing. I thought that only then would my records last for a long time."

After viewing the house, Ahn Jung-hwan, Hong Hyun-hee, and Park Tae-hwan talked about how they first started swimming and their parents who supported them while fighting cancer. Park Tae-hwan, who was said to have been so afraid of water that he hid behind a pillar in the swimming pool, impressed everyone by revealing that when he saw his mother, who had cancer, being happy watching him compete when he was in elementary school, he decided, “I will devote my life to swimming.”
